Reactable

Reactable is an electronic musical instrument with a Tangible User Interface tabletop that enables visitors to create a wide range of exciting digital music. By placing blocks called tangibles on the table that interface with the visual display, visitors control virtual synthesizers and sequencers to create music or sound effects. The instrument captivates through direct and immediate feedback and guides the player to understand and explore sound generation in an intuitive way, no matter the age or musical knowledge.

Its multi-user capability allows several players to use the installation simultaneously and promotes collaborative compositions. A visual display of the tabletop is projected onto the white wall next to the exhibit so other visitors of the museum are able to watch the action from a distance. Reactable is accessible to all ages.

Location:

MOXI, The Wolf Museum of Exploration + Innovation, Santa Barbara, CA
